About This Job

Job Summary:

As an IT Support Officer at Eden Leisure Group, you will be responsible for maintaining and troubleshooting the group's technology infrastructure, ensuring that all systems and devices operate efficiently. You will work closely with the CTO to provide technical support to both clients and staff, guaranteeing a seamless and enjoyable experience for everyone.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Staff Support:
    • Assist company staff with any technical issues related to computers, software, hardware, and other IT equipment.
    • Conduct regular training sessions for staff on IT protocols and best practices.
  • System Maintenance:
    • Perform routine maintenance on computer systems, servers, and other IT equipment to ensure optimal performance.
    • Collaborate with the CTO to implement system upgrades and enhancements.
  • Network Management:
    • Monitor and maintain the group's network infrastructure, ensuring high-speed and reliable connectivity.
    • Troubleshoot network issues and coordinate with external vendors when necessary.
  • Security Compliance:
    • Implement and enforce IT security policies to safeguard sensitive information.
    • Conduct regular audits to identify and address potential security vulnerabilities.
  • Inventory Management:
    • Keep track of IT inventory, including computers, peripherals, and software licenses.
    • Assist in procurement processes for new IT equipment and services.
  • Emergency Response:
    • Provide on-call support for emergency IT issues outside regular working hours.
    • Collaborate with other departments to ensure swift resolution of critical technical issues.

Qualifications:

  • Diploma in Information Technology, or a related field.
  • Proven experience in technical support.
  • Strong knowledge of computer systems, networks, and IT security protocols.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to work under pressure and provide timely solutions.
